Heey guys, I am trying to repair one channel of my Quad 606 power amp.
Initially, I found that T9 had blown and shorted itself out. All terminals pretty much measuring 0Ω between each other. So I removed it. I also replaced R38 (2k2 in the top right corner which was burnt).
I replaced the fuse and turned it back on (still without T9) and the next one (T10) blew short straight away.
I am guessing it’s something to do with this T15/T16 voltage reference network, but I can’t easily just remove the load to test it without cutting traces.
Do you think I should I just try to replace T15/T16 next? Any suggestions for modern replacements to the ZTX652/752?
